Showers to continue till month end

Ranchi: Jharkhand will continue to receive light to moderate showers till August 31, the Ranchi office of the India Meteorological Department (IMD) said on Thursday.
In its afternoon weather bulletin, IMD (Ranchi) said Khunti’s Torpa received the highest amount of rainfall in the past 24 hours, measuring 79.2mm on the rain gauge. Simdega received 60mm rain while Kuru in Lohardaga received 50mm rain. Gumla, Daltonganj and Garhwa received 30mm rain each while Lohardaga, Hazaribag, Deoghar and Dhanbad recorded 20mm each rain. Ranchi, Bokaro, Jamshedpur and Kodema recorded 10mm rain each.
“The well-marked low pressure is lying over southwest Jharkhand and its neighbourhood. In the next 48 hours, it will move westwards and its effect over Jharkhand will gradually wean,” Abhishek Anand, scientist at IMD (Ranchi), said.
The weather office said monsoon will remain normal in the state between August 28 and August 31 and under its effect, light to moderate showers will be experienced in most parts of Jharkhand.
Jharkhand, which remained in the rainfall deficit zone in the last couple of years, has been receiving bountiful showers this year. From June 1 to Thursday, Jharkhand received 743.7mm rain, which is 6% less than its normal average of 787.5mm. IMD, Ranchi said eight districts have received excess rains so far, while five districts have a deficit of 19% or more. Palamu has received 35% excess rains than its normal average, the highest in the state, while Gumla has the maximum deficit (49%).
Ranchi, which has received 775.4mm rains, has a deficit of 4%. However, the continuous rain has pushed the reservoirs across the state capital to its optimum capacity. On Thursday, Gonda Dam officials released water from its three gates as the reservoir’s water level touched the 28ft-mark.
